\(H=\{\text { cat, dog, rabbit, mouse }\}, F=\{\text { dog, cow, duck, pig, rabbit }\} \quad W=\{\text { duck, rabbit, deer, frog, mouse }\}\), a) We start with the intersection: \(H \cap F=\{\text { dog, rabbit }\}\), Now we union that result with \(W:(H \cap F) \cup W=\{\text{dog, duck, rabbit, deer, frog, mouse }\}\), b) We start with the union: \(F \cup W=\{\text{dog, cow, rabbit, duck, pig, deer, frog, mouse }\}\), Now we intersect that result with \(H: H \cap(F \cup W)=\{\text { dog, rabbit, mouse }\}\), c) We start with the intersection: \(H \cap F=\{\mathrm{dog}, \text { rabbit }\}\), Now we want to find the elements of \(W\) that are not in \(\mathrm{H} \cap F\), \((H \cap P)^{c} \cap W=\{\text { duck, deer, frog, mouse }\}\). in set B, so we're going to take out Shouldn't you have Property 2: The difference between a non-empty set and an empty set is the set itself, i.e, X = X. The following assumes the sets are stored as a sorted container (as std::set does). Two Sets to Build Difference. Can I use an 11 watt LED bulb in a lamp rated for 8.6 watts maximum? The symbol we use for the intersection is \(\cap\). Does it matter in what order species appear in sets? First, let A be the set of numbers of units that represents "more than 12 units". Not the answer you're looking for? Notice that in the example above, we do not need a universal set since we are using complement together with the intersection operation. JFIF C Note that this question can most easily be answered by creating a Venn diagram (discussed in the next section and pictured here). (a) How many people listened using either streaming services or the radio? For simplicity's sake, we'll work with two in the examples below. Which was the first Sci-Fi story to predict obnoxious "robo calls"? The statement to be proved is $$ (A\setminus B) \cup (A\cap B) \cup (B\setminus A) = A\cup B, $$ which is equivalent (by definition of set equality) to the pair of inclusions $$ (A\setminus B) \cup (A\cap B) \cup (B\setminus A) \subset A\cup B \quad\text{and}\quad A . The symbol for a null set does look like a zero doesn't it? Assuming that students only take a whole number of units, write this in set notation as the intersection of two sets and then write out this intersection. What is the difference between set intersection and set difference? So, by giving these sets two different names, you have created two different, distinct sets. Is "I didn't think it was serious" usually a good defence against "duty to rescue"? Venn diagrams play a significant role in set theory to depict the various set operations. Moreover, the set difference is one of the operations on sets. The difference between sets of X and Y is denoted by the symbol X Y or simply we write it as X Minus Y. Lastly, the outcome X minus Y is not the same as Y minus X. A and then we would have had 3) if a = b: a = next elem of A and b = next elem of B clear () Removes all the elements from the set. These are common, but usually easy to debug. So far we read what difference between sets is, how to calculate the same for different sets, and various properties relating to it. The code defines two sets, set1 and set2, and then uses the union, intersection, difference, and symmetric difference operators on them. Completion API. 6 is only in set B and not in set A. What is the difference between canonical name, simple name and class name in Java Class? There we saw the Venn diagram of P Q and Q P. This is quite clear that the resultant of P Q is not equal to Q P, i.e. Two Sets to Build Difference Assign Passage Vocabulary Activity Question Set Your browser does not support playing our audio. And in both cases, I've defined The word that you will often see that indicates a union is "or". I am a grad student and this problem came up in my research work. This page titled The Union and Intersection of Two Sets is shared under a CC BY 4.0 license and was authored, remixed, and/or curated by Larry Green. Mathematically expressed as X - X = . Also, reach out to the test series available to examine your knowledge regarding several exams. Write this event using set notation. On the complexity - using these ordered merge-like algorithms is O(n) provided you can do the in-order traversals in O(n). Direct link to Judah Hoover's post Null is different than ze, Posted 10 years ago. A B can also be written as A / B. Happy coding! The complement of a set A contains everything that is not in the set A. So let's think about c) Here we're looking for all the elements that are not in set \(A\) and are also in \(C\). So you get the 5, the 3. Check out what is set difference, how to find the difference between two sets, and solved examples in the following sections. I'm wondering if there is a quick/clean way to get the symmetric difference between two sets ? 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. You must treat them as such. Likewise, B A returns a new set with only Ruby: If you dont specify any parameters to the difference function, a copy of the set is returned: You can verify it was copied by printing the memory address: You wont see the identical values, and thats not the point. Ill receive a portion of your membership fee if you use the following link, with no extra cost to you. Connect and share knowledge within a single location that is structured and easy to search. R "2#BRbr$3C 1!4ASc%Qs5D&Taq'Eu ? Direct link to webuyanycar.com's post Yes, you must treat them , Posted 7 years ago. the complement of A that happens to Direct link to kaivalya.panyam's post PLEASE dont laugh at my i, Posted 8 years ago. A B = {x : x A and x B}. For simplicitys sake, well work with two in the examples below. Audio for question sets: where is it?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Direct link to SteveSargentJr's post Great question! That's why 6 isn't in the set A-B. Since \(n(S) = 420\), \(n(R)=140\), and \(n(S\cap R) = 110\), we can use our formula to get: \(n(S \cup R) = 420 + 140 - 110 = 450\) people. This error occurs when you try to use shorthand notation (minus sign) on invalid data types. Check out what is set difference, how to find the difference between two sets, and solved examples in the following sections. Take a look at the following two sets A and B: Calculating a difference between these sets means well get a new set with a single element PHP. This property suggests that the thing which we need to be careful of in the difference of sets is the order of sets. The idea is that when you look at the heads of the two lists, you can determine which is the lower, extract that, and add it to the tail of the output, then repeat. It is an operation on sets that contains all elements of both sets without repeating element/s. A Venn diagram utilizes overlapping circles or different shapes to represent the logical associations between two or more finite sets of items. What positional accuracy (ie, arc seconds) is necessary to view Saturn, Uranus, beyond? 4) if b goes to end: insert rest of A into C and stop Only shade in the final answer for each exercise. The difference between the two sets is denoted as the first set the second set. I hope that this article has helped you develop a better understanding of the Python set union function. Determine all integers that satisfy the following two conditions: The elements of the first array are all factors of the integer being considered. There are three good ways to go about it. A taken out of it. There are variants which detect the case where the two heads are equal, and treat this specially. We can write: \[A=\left\{2,4,6\right\},\:\:\:B\:=\:\left\{3\right\} \nonumber \]. Similarly, the below Venn diagram shows Q P. The resultant set is received by withdrawing the elements of P Q from Q. Symbolically written as Q P and read as Q minus P. That is expressing the union of the two sets in words. What is the difference between ++i and i++? Summing up the article we can state that the difference between sets X and Y in this particular order is the set of components that are present in set X but not in set Y. that are in set A out of it. Next, since we want "not even" we need to consider the complement of A: Similarly since we want "not a 3", we need to consider the complement of B: \[B^c=\left\{1,2,4,5,6\right\} \nonumber \]. lot more about complements in the future. We can write: \[A=\left\{x\mid x>8\right\},\:\:\:B\:=\:\left\{x\mid x<6\right\},\:C=\left\{x\mid x<3\right\} \nonumber \], \[A\cup\left(B\cap C^c\right) \nonumber \]. A well-written subrange copy for a binary tree is O(n). set B taken out of set A. we have to take the 17 out. A-B={a, e, i, o, u}-{a, b, c, d, e}={ i, o, u}, B-A={a, b, c, d, e}-{a, e, i, o, u}={b, c, d}. For example, you and a new roommate decide to have a house party, and you both invite your circle of friends. There will be two arrays of integers. He finds the following interesting facts: Basketball superstar Michael Jordan was a geography major at the University of North Carolina. Data Scientist & Tech Writer | betterdatascience.com, Machine Learning Automation with TPOT: Build, validate, and deploy fully automated machine learning models with Python, Python If-Else Statement in One Line Ternary Operator Explained. And when you subtract a set, if Since the universal set contains \(100\) of people and the cardinality of \(F \cup T=45\), the cardinality of \((F \cup T)^{c}\) must be the other \(55\). How do you solve the complement of sets? First, sequencing. the set of all of the objects that are in A with Lets now explore a shorter way to get the set difference by using the minus operator. taking that element out of it doesn't change it. The first is A, the second is B. extends T> a, Set

Delegated Examining Certification Practice Test, International Rescue Committee Controversy, Tax Products Pe1 Sbtpg Llc, Articles T